While all pledged funds are not yet in, JA Director of the Catawba Region, Ann Elliott reports the event has brought in at least $15,000 at this time. That's a fantastic response and will insure that thousands of elementary and middle school students in York, Chester and Lancaster Counties of SC will once again be able to participate in Junior Achievement programs, and that new teacher requests for the classes can also be funded as additional pledged funds are received.
